.catalog{background:#fff}.catalog__inner{width:100%}.catalog__container{position:relative;width:100%}.catalog__header{display:flex;align-items:flex-end;justify-content:space-between;gap:1rem;padding:1.25rem;min-height:7.5rem;box-sizing:border-box}.catalog__heading{max-width:13rem}.catalog__cta{padding:.625rem .75rem;white-space:nowrap;flex-shrink:0}.catalog__scroller{display:flex;flex-direction:column;align-items:stretch;overflow:visible;scroll-snap-type:none}.catalog__item{display:flex;width:100%}.catalog__item>.product-card{width:100%}@media screen and (min-width:600px){.catalog__heading{max-width:none}.catalog__scroller{flex-direction:row;overflow-x:auto;overflow-y:hidden;scroll-snap-type:x mandatory;scrollbar-width:none;-ms-overflow-style:none;-webkit-overflow-scrolling:touch}.catalog__scroller::-webkit-scrollbar{display:none}.catalog__item{flex:0 0 50%;scroll-snap-align:center}}@media screen and (min-width:1024px){.catalog__item{flex-basis:33.3333%}}.catalog__slider{display:contents}.catalog__pagination{display:none}@media screen and (min-width:600px){.catalog__pagination{display:flex;align-items:center;justify-content:center;height:2.6875rem;width:100%;background:#fff;border-top:1px solid #000000}.catalog__pagination-dots{gap:.3125rem}.catalog__pagination-dots .pagination-dot{width:2.125rem;height:1px;min-height:0;border-radius:0;padding:.75rem 0;background-color:transparent;background-image:linear-gradient(#000,#000);background-repeat:no-repeat;background-position:center;background-size:100% 1px;opacity:.25;transition:background-size .2s ease,opacity .2s ease}.catalog__pagination-dots .pagination-dot:before{display:none}.catalog__pagination-dots .pagination-dot.is-active{background-image:linear-gradient(#000,#000);background-size:100% 2px;opacity:1}}
/*# sourceMappingURL=/cdn/shop/t/14/assets/section-catalog.css.map */
